Decoding the Weather Signs

To answer this burning question, we need to consult the oracles of our time: weather apps, websites, and maybe even a quick glance out the window (if you dare). Here's what to look for:

  • The dreaded "P" word: If you see "precipitation" or "chance of rain" anywhere, that's a red flag (or maybe a grey cloud?). The higher the percentage, the higher the chance you'll need your trusty umbrella (or a garbage bag, if you're truly desperate).
  • Cloud cover: Are the skies looking like a giant cotton ball exploded? That's not a good sign. Clear skies are your friend. Overcast skies are the friend who sometimes forgets to pay you back for lunch.
  • Humidity: If the air feels like you're walking through a sauna, rain might be on the way. High humidity + dark clouds = potential downpour.
  • Wind: A sudden change in wind direction can sometimes indicate an approaching storm. So, if your hair is suddenly doing its own interpretive dance, be warned.
